繁体   English   中英

如何格式化 WSO2 EI Rest API 中的日期字段

[英]How to format the date field in WSO2 EI Rest API

我想从 WSo2 EI REST API 中格式化 Date 字段,目前我收到以下格式的响应。

{
    "Members": {
        "member": [
            {
                "First_Name": "FLORENCE       ",
                "Effective_Date": "2019-05-01-07:00"
}]}}

但我希望回应像

                "Effective_Date": "2019-05-01"

我试过 "Effective_Date":"$effective_date(type:dateTime, 'YYYY-MM-DD')"

<config id="DataSource"> 
    <property name="jndi_resource_name">jdbc/datasourcename</property>
</config> 
<query id="get_new_touchMembers" useConfig="DataSource"> 
    <sql>EXECUTE databasename..SP_NAME</sql> 
    <result outputType="json"> {
     "Members":{ "member":[ { "S.NO":"$s.NO", "ID":"$id", "DOB":"$dob", "Effective_Date":"$effective_date", "Term_Date":"$term_date", "Plan_Description":"$plan_description" } ] } } </result> 
</query>

试试这个属性,因为它对我有用!

<property expression="get-property('SYSTEM_DATE', 'yyyy-MM-dd')" name="effective_date" scope="default"/>

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M